dns指的什么

DNS,全称为Domain Name System,中文名为“域名系统”,是互联网提供的一项基础服务,它负责将人们易于记忆的域名(如www.example.com)解析成计算机能够直接识别的IP地址(如192.0.2.1),解决了上网设备的命名问题。

dns指的什么

在详细工作原理上,可以把DNS形象地比喻成一本电话簿,我们想要给一个叫做"李毛毛"的朋友打电话,我们没法直接通过"李毛毛"这个名字来打电话,而必须知道他的电话号码才能拨通电话,如果朋友太多,电话号码难以记住,就需要电话簿来帮助我们找到朋友们的电话号码,同样,当我们在浏览器中输入一个网址时,计算机需要通过IP地址找到这个网址对应的服务器,由于IP地址是由一串数字组成的,难以记忆,因此我们需要DNS来将这串数字转化为更便于人类理解的域名。

DNS是一个分布式、层次化的数据库系统,使用UDP端口53进行通信,其不仅将域名映射到IP地址,还提供了反向查询机制,即从IP地址反解出域名,为了方便管理,DNS对各级域名长度进行了限制,其中每一级域名长度不能超过63个字符,而域名总长度则不能超过253个字符,DNS就是互联网的电话簿,它将方便人类记忆的域名转换为机器能理解的IP地址,使得互联网的使用变得更加便捷。

DNS(Domain Name System,域名系统)是一个用于将域名和IP地址相互转换的分布式数据库,它使得用户可以通过使用容易记忆的域名来访问网站,而不需要记住复杂的IP地址。

下面是一个简单的介绍,展示了DNS中一些基本的概念和对应的解释:

DNS术语 解释
域名(Domain Name) 用来表示一个IP地址的容易记忆的字符串,如www.example.com
IP地址(IP Address) 互联网上设备的数字标识,如192.0.2.1
DNS服务器(DNS Server) 用来解析域名到IP地址的服务器
解析(Resolution) 将域名转换为IP地址的过程
根域名服务器(Root DNS Server) DNS解析过程中的起点,负责指向顶级域名服务器
顶级域名服务器(Top-Level Domain DNS Server) 负责管理如.com.org 等顶级域名的服务器
二级域名服务器(Second-Level Domain DNS Server) 管理具体域名如example.com 的服务器
主DNS服务器(Primary DNS Server) 负责存储某个域名的权威DNS记录的服务器
从DNS服务器(Secondary DNS Server) 从主DNS服务器复制DNS记录的服务器,用于冗余和负载均衡
缓存(Cache) DNS解析结果在DNS服务器或本地计算机中的临时存储,可以加快解析速度
TTL(Time to Live) DNS记录在缓存中的有效时间,之后需要重新查询

通过这个介绍,可以简单了解DNS的相关术语和功能,DNS系统是互联网能够正常运行的重要基础设施之一。

图片来源于互联网,如侵权请联系管理员。发布者:观察员,转转请注明出处:https://www.kname.net/ask/42102.html

(0)
观察员观察员
上一篇 2024年6月9日 06:05
下一篇 2024年6月9日 06:08

相关推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注